About Investment Law in Schiphol, Netherlands:

Investment law in Schiphol, Netherlands pertains to the regulations and guidelines that govern the process of investing in businesses, properties, or ventures within the Schiphol region. It involves various legal considerations, such as contract negotiations, regulatory compliance, taxation, and dispute resolution.

Why You May Need a Lawyer:

There are several situations where individuals may require legal assistance in investment matters, such as drafting or reviewing investment agreements, resolving disputes with business partners, navigating complex regulatory frameworks, or seeking guidance on tax implications of investments.

Local Laws Overview:

Key aspects of local laws in Schiphol, Netherlands relevant to investment include compliance with Dutch corporate laws, understanding tax obligations for investors, adhering to regulations set by the Dutch financial authorities, and ensuring transparency in investment transactions.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What are the legal requirements for investing in Schiphol, Netherlands?

Investors need to comply with Dutch corporate laws, obtain necessary permits/licenses, abide by tax regulations, and ensure compliance with financial regulations.

2. How can a lawyer assist with investment agreements?

A lawyer can help draft, review, and negotiate investment agreements to protect your interests, clarify terms, and ensure legal compliance.

3. What are the tax implications of investments in Schiphol, Netherlands?

Investors may be subject to corporate taxes, capital gains taxes, and other tax obligations based on their investments in Schiphol. Consulting with a tax lawyer can help navigate these complexities.

4. How can a lawyer help in resolving investment disputes?

A lawyer can provide legal advice, represent clients in negotiations, mediation, or arbitration, and litigate in court if necessary to resolve investment disputes effectively.

5. What are the benefits of seeking legal advice before making an investment?

Legal advice can help mitigate risks, protect your rights, ensure compliance with laws, enhance the success of investments, and avoid costly legal pitfalls down the line.

6. How can I ensure my investment is legally protected in Schiphol, Netherlands?

By working with a qualified lawyer, you can draft sound investment agreements, conduct due diligence, secure intellectual property rights, and safeguard your investments through legal mechanisms.

7. What role does regulatory compliance play in investments in Schiphol, Netherlands?

Compliance with local regulations is crucial for investors to avoid legal penalties, maintain good standing with authorities, protect their investments, and uphold ethical business practices.

8. Are there any specialized legal services for foreign investors in Schiphol, Netherlands?

Law firms in Schiphol may offer specialized services for foreign investors, such as advising on cross-border investments, international tax planning, and navigating cultural differences in business transactions.
